How much do digital strategy director j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average yearly pay for digital strategy director in Decatur, GA is $139,091.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$104,500.00 and $171,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a digital strategy director do?

A digital strategy director develops and oversees a company's online marketing and digital initiatives to align with business goals. They analyze market trends, coordinate cross-functional teams, and use tools like analytics platforms to optimize digital campaigns and improve online presence.

How does a digital strategy director typ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

A Digital Strategy Director works closely with various departments such as marketing, IT, sales, and product development to ensure digital initiatives align with overall business goals. Collaboration often involves leading cross-functional teams, facilitating communication between stakeholders, and translating digital objectives into actionable plans. This role requires a strong ability to build consensus, manage expectations, and integrate feedback from multiple sources to drive cohesive digital transformation efforts.

Job Title: Senior Director, Digital, Loyalty & Off-Premise

Reports To: VP Digital & Loyalty

Department: Marketing

Job Summary:

The Senior Director, Digital, Loyalty & Off-Premise will lead Church's digital guest experience and commercial growth across owned ordering channels, third-party delivery, catering and be the owner and champion for our Real Rewards loyalty program and all CRM initiatives. This role owns strategy, execution, performance, and profitability for digital direct and off-premise channels, partnering cross-functionally with Brand Marketing, Operations, IT, Finance, Legal, Supply Chain, Analytics, vendors, and franchise stakeholders to improve guest engagement, increase frequency and spend and grow profitable sales.

Key Duties/Responsibilities:

  • Direct & Off-Premise Strategy: Own the overall strategy, performance and profitability for first- and third-party digital ordering, delivery and catering programs.
  • Loyalty & CRM Strategy: Lead loyalty, CRM (email, SMS, Push), segmentation, lifecycle marketing, and customer journey strategies that grow Real Rewards member acquisition, activation, engagement, retention, and customer lifetime value. This leader will spearhead development of data-driven, audience-centric campaigns and automated journeys to make our guests' experiences as personalized and valuable as possible.
  • Driving First-Party Ordering Growth: Lead the continued growth of direct online ordering sales through churchs.com and our native mobile apps, leveraging CRM, partnering with stakeholders that include brand, menu innovation, digital product management and menu management.
  • Third-Party Marketplace Partner Management: Lead business and relationships with third-party delivery platforms (ex. DoorDash, UberEats, GrubHub, Favor, ezCater) to deliver great guest experiences, fuel discovery of our brand and optimize marketplace performance and profitability.
  • Own and Grow Church's Catering: Lead the launch and growth of our catering program including go-to-market strategy (ex. lead acquisition, qualification, nurture); guide offer strategy, marketing and CRM campaign planning and partner w/ Operations & Training for smooth execution.
  • Collaborate with Digital Experience team to ensure outbound CRM messaging connects with our website and native apps deliver seamless guest online order experiences.
  • Data, Insights & Reporting: Partner closely with our Data & Analytics team to track and evaluate performance of all revenue channels, identify opportunities, and communicate clear recommendations to leadership and franchise stakeholders.
  • Cross-Functional Partnerships & Communication: Collaborate with Brand, Menu, IT, Operations, Training, Legal, Finance, Corporate Communications and franchise stakeholders to ensure holistic awareness, support and compliance.
  • Compliance, Fraud & Risk Management: Partner with IT, Legal and Digital Experience to maintain compliance (ex. guest data privacy, accessibility), mitigate fraud risks and other potential bad actors.

Position Requirements (Education, Qualifications, Experience):

  • 7-12 years of digital leadership experience in QSR or Fast-Casual overseeing digital and off-premise commerce (including catering)
  • Demonstrated expertise leading and managing loyalty programs and mulit-channel CRM programs; a digital marketing native that has worked with a CDP, enterprise CRM platforms and understands and can keep up with technical dependencies (APIs, webhooks) to execute data-driven personalization and messaging at scale.
  • Direct experience managing external partners that includes loyalty (ex. Punchh, Thanx, Paytronix, etc), first-party ordering (ex. Olo) and third-party marketplaces (ex. DoorDash, UberEats, ezCater)
  • Analytical leader with strong communication, problem-solving, project management, presentation, organization, and prioritization skills.
  • Strong analytical skills (Excel required) and comfort with BI / reporting tools (e.g., Tableau, Power BI) to translate insights into action.
  • Proven ability to lead, communicate, negotiate, and influence effectively across cross-functional teams and franchise stakeholders, with strong collaboration, change management, prioritization, and budget discipline.
